Thunderbolts Adventure - 10th Anniversary


  • The Roundabout Inn Gloucester NSW Australia (map)

The legend lives on. Australia's greatest and longest running gravel monument. This will be the 10th anniversary edition and we want you to join us.

Starting with registration on Friday night at The Roundabout Inn, we'll then get an early night and gather at 5am for the Anzac Day dawn service in Gloucester. The Monument riders will then set off first, followed by the Colt and Remington a little later in the morning.

Saturday night we'll all gather at the Avon Valley Inn and welcome the Monument and Flashpacker riders as they arrive to join the most memorable gravel celebration ever!

Sunday morning will be an optional informal coffee ride.

Choose from a number of course options:

  • The Monument: 173km and 3,500 vertical metres

  • The Colt: 93km and 1,460 vertical metres

  • The Remington: 46km and 602 vertical metres

  • The Pilgrim: Choose from a number of fully vetted routes starting in different locations and ride self-supported to arrive in Gloucester the evening of April 25 and join the celebration. This is designed as a multi-day bike-packing experience.

NOTE: There is no overnighter for 2026. There "may" be a very casual recovery/coffee ride Sunday morning. Meet at The Common ready to roll out at 8am.

The Monument:

The classic course but not as you know it. In 2026 we will be bypassing Moonan Flat by following Pheasant Creek Rd off the range, thereby reducing the challenge to something a little more accessible for our weekend warriors. There are strict cutoffs and standards to be met if you want to give this a go. Start preparing now.

The Colt:

New in 2025, "The Colt" rose to instant success with all the gravel you love without the quad busting climbs and we get you back to Gloucester for a nap so you are ready to celebrate on Saturday night. Book the accomodation of your choice. 93km and 1460 vertical meters is a solid day out in anyone’s books, but totally acheivable.

The Remington:

For those who prefer to tour at a relaxed pace. If you like to stop for a coffee, turn off for a picnic, and take a stroll to admire the view, this one is for you. Enjoy this course that takes in some of the best backroads surrounding Gloucester.

The Pilgrim:

If you like to carry all the gear and set off on a multi-day adventure, sign up for this one. We'll provide you with a choice of vetted courses and be waiting to welcome you in Gloucester at the finish.

History: The Barrington Tops lies at the boundary of three Aboriginal territories, the lands of the Worimi people of the south-east, the Biripi people of the east and the Wonnarua people of the west. Graveleur would like to acknowledge the traditional owners of these lands and pay our respects to elders past, present and emerging.
